繁体   English   中英

将Skybox添加到Autodesk Forge Viewer的最佳方法

[英]Best way to add skybox to Autodesk Forge Viewer

我正在尝试在Forge Viewer中向模型添加一个Skybox。 到目前为止,我已经设法通过扩展创建了Skybox并将其添加到模型中。 问题在于,天盒需要很大,而相机的后夹平面将变短。 -例如 天空盒仅部分可见或隐藏。

我没有设法修改相机设置来更改剪切平面,因此正在考虑另一种方法:

我想知道将天空盒保存在单独的ThreeJS场景中是否更好,但是到目前为止,我仍无法弄清楚应如何将额外的场景添加到Autodesks Viewer3D中,也不能与主摄像机保持同步。回转。

任何指针和示例将不胜感激

加载额外的场景对于实现该功能可能是一个过大的选择,最简单的解决方法是加载第二个模型,该模型的扩展范围比天空盒的扩展稍大,因此查看器将自动更新其剪裁平面。

我建议您做的是转换一个仅包含微小球体或立方体的模型,这些模型定义了所需的天空盒场景扩展。 然后,即使您的其他模型是从云中加载的,也可以使用其缸或下载其资源并“本地”加载该模型。

请参阅此处以获取有关提取可见资源以及运行基于本地与基于云的更多详细信息:

https://extract.autodesk.io

使用Forge Viewer开发Web应用程序时,可以无缝地在线/离线工作

希望能有所帮助

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M